The area boasts many stately homes within a short driving distance: The impressive Floors Castle at Kelso, Paxton House, Mellerstain, Thirlstaine, Manderston and also the quaint Smailholme Tower, home of Sir Walter Scott. Nearby are the grounds of Duns Castle and The Hirsel, both ideal for a morning or afternoon stroll. Further afield is Abbotsford House near the lovely town of Melrose.
Just a short drive away is the town of Berwick-upon-Tweed, which is home to the fascinating ruins of the once impressive Elizabethan Berwick Castle with the town ramparts which can be walked in their entirety. To the south and north of Berwick is the fantastic coastline, including the glorious beaches of north Northumberland. Further south, the coastline takes in the many historic Northumberland Castles including Alnwick Castle and Holy Island. Perched on the northern bank of the River Tweed is the bustling town of Coldstream, well-known for being home to the famous Coldstream Guards. The town boasts a good selection of amenities, including independent shops and welcoming pubs, a museum dedicated to the Coldstream Guards and a host of activities including cycling, walking, riding, golf and fishing, there is something for everyone! Just a short distance away from the town centre are the fascinating remains of the once impressive Twizel Castle, perfect for exploring the town's history.
